Laconic state machine
Go to file
Federico Kunze Küllmer 5d2798aa7e
docs: re-license to LGPLv3 (#800)
* docs: re-license to LGPLv3

* changelog
2021-11-30 09:22:21 +01:00
.bencher ci: add bencher config (#652) 2021-10-08 12:07:03 +00:00
.github ci: enable gosec sarif upload (#776) 2021-11-24 11:42:47 +00:00
app ante: remove unused AccessListDecorator (#797) 2021-11-30 09:06:34 +01:00
client fix: gosec issues (#779) 2021-11-25 15:12:57 +00:00
cmd feat: store migration setup (#794) 2021-11-29 16:46:20 +01:00
contrib/scripts ci: liveness test (#498) 2021-08-26 15:21:43 +00:00
crypto crypto: updates from reviews (#535) 2021-09-07 17:29:24 +00:00
docs rpc: debug_traceTransaction fails for succesful tx (#720) 2021-11-09 18:38:22 +00:00
encoding encoding: rm MsgEthereumTx custom support in TxConfig (#714) 2021-11-02 11:24:24 +01:00
log log: add benchmark for handler.Log (#494) 2021-08-26 10:36:07 +00:00
networks/local [Snyk] Security upgrade golang from 1.16.7 to 1.16 (#670) 2021-10-14 07:39:48 +00:00
proto rpc: debug_traceTransaction fails for succesful tx (#720) 2021-11-09 18:38:22 +00:00
rpc Fix get block (#781) 2021-11-26 18:10:40 +00:00
scripts tests: integration tests with JSON-RPC client (#704) 2021-11-14 14:34:10 +01:00
server fix: gosec issues (#779) 2021-11-25 15:12:57 +00:00
tests fix: RPC tests fail if FeeMarket BaseFee is enabled by default (#770) 2021-11-23 15:00:25 +00:00
testutil/network fix: gosec issues (#779) 2021-11-25 15:12:57 +00:00
third_party/proto evm: EIP1559 & go-ethereum related updates (#469) 2021-08-25 14:45:51 +00:00
tools tests: integration tests with JSON-RPC client (#704) 2021-11-14 14:34:10 +01:00
types evm: check height overflow (#597) 2021-09-28 09:48:11 +00:00
version more fixes 2021-04-18 18:39:15 +02:00
x feat: store migration setup (#794) 2021-11-29 16:46:20 +01:00
.clang-format ci: enable backport for v0.8 and v0.7 (#784) 2021-11-25 11:06:30 +00:00
.dockerignore build: fix docker setup (#337) 2021-08-04 09:30:13 +00:00
.gitattributes add gitattributes file (#567) 2021-09-16 08:36:08 +00:00
.gitignore build: fix docker setup (#337) 2021-08-04 09:30:13 +00:00
.golangci.yml tests: integration tests with JSON-RPC client (#704) 2021-11-14 14:34:10 +01:00
.goreleaser.yml ci: fix goreleaser (#708) 2021-10-29 15:56:09 +02:00
.mergify.yml ci: enable backport for v0.8 and v0.7 (#784) 2021-11-25 11:06:30 +00:00
buf.work.yaml evm: EIP1559 & go-ethereum related updates (#469) 2021-08-25 14:45:51 +00:00
CHANGELOG.md docs: re-license to LGPLv3 (#800) 2021-11-30 09:22:21 +01:00
CODE_OF_CONDUCT.md Create CODE_OF_CONDUCT.md 2018-07-17 11:52:20 -04:00
codecov.yml all: linter (#532) 2021-09-05 11:03:06 +00:00
CONTRIBUTING.md doc: duplicated documentation removed (#603) 2021-09-29 10:37:10 +00:00
docker-compose.yml build: fix docker setup (#337) 2021-08-04 09:30:13 +00:00
Dockerfile build: fix docker setup (#337) 2021-08-04 09:30:13 +00:00
go.mod fix: improve error message in SendTransaction json-rpc api (#786) 2021-11-26 15:19:28 +01:00
go.sum fix: improve error message in SendTransaction json-rpc api (#786) 2021-11-26 15:19:28 +01:00
gometalinter.json Upgrade geth and cleanup 2018-09-28 17:40:58 -04:00
init.bat feat: update chain-id format (#447) 2021-08-17 14:11:26 +00:00
init.sh fix: set EVM debug based on tracer config (#746) 2021-11-16 08:57:03 +00:00
LICENSE docs: re-license to LGPLv3 (#800) 2021-11-30 09:22:21 +01:00
Makefile fix: proto-gen broken env var (#723) 2021-11-06 22:01:58 +00:00
README.md Update README.md (#736) 2021-11-09 19:50:27 +00:00
starport.yml ci: liveness test (#498) 2021-08-26 15:21:43 +00:00

Ethermint

banner

Ethermint is a scalable and interoperable Ethereum library, built on Proof-of-Stake with fast-finality using the Cosmos SDK which runs on top of Tendermint Core consensus engine.

Note: Requires Go 1.17+

Installation

For prerequisites and detailed build instructions please read the Evmos Installation instructions. Once the dependencies are installed, run:

make install

Or check out the latest release.

Quick Start

To learn how the Ethermint works from a high-level perspective, go to the Introduction section from the documentation. You can also check the instructions to Run a Node.

For an example on how Ethermint can be used on any Cosmos-SDK chain, please refer to Evmos.

Community

The following chat channels and forums are a great spot to ask questions about Ethermint:

Contributing

Looking for a good place to start contributing? Check out some good first issues.

For additional instructions, standards and style guides, please refer to the Contributing document.

Careers

See our open positions on Cosmos Jobs, Notion, or feel free to reach out via email.